- The distance between Naze, Japan and Dubuque, Ia, Usa is approximately 11,133 km or 6,918 mi.
- To reach Naze in this distance one would set out from Dubuque, Ia bearing 324.8°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Naze bearing 209° or SSW .
- Naze has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Dubuque, Ia has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- The annual mean temperature is 13.3 °C (23.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.1 °C (30.8°F) less in Naze.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1896.4 mm (74.7 in) more which is equivalent to 1896.4 l/m² (46.54 US gal/ft²) or 18,964,000 l/ha (2,027,377 US gal/ac) more. About 3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14° higher in Naze than in Dubuque, Ia.
